Book Description

Brad Ashton fled three years ago to avoid a conviction for murder. Now he's back. And his hope for freedom appears to be within reach.

Unfortunately there are those who have no interest in his legal status; they only want him dead or on the run once more.

But for Brad, running is no longer an option. It's a table stakes game in which the risks are high. But he puts everything he has, including his life, on the table, then settles in, determined to win every hand.

Free To Die . . . . Bob McElwain

Tom Fairchild AKA Brad Aston is wanted in L.A. for a murder he did not commit.
This novel relates the story of how he clears his name. It contains a fair amount of violence. But, for the most part, the violence is necessary for the plot.
The book is well written, the character development is good and the story line is intriguing and held my interest from start to finish.
If you are in the mood for a mystery that is dotted with bullets and blood, you will enjoy this novel.
Keeping in mind the type of tale it is, I rated it 5 stars.
